Output 54d0fe86fe257a6860982932a3c2a1b12cdbcfa598e1f30d033e54c964844975:31

value
32467214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91433c6bde7310b97ee1f1e04e3c69820854f497 OP_EQUAL
address
3Ew6SzwaZ7W9wUWNBakZ9vh3B3gnTeWJSd
transaction
54d0fe86fe257a6860982932a3c2a1b12cdbcfa598e1f30d033e54c964844975
spent
true